1. KVC的实现原理 遍历字典里面所有的key,以name为例 去模型中查找有没有setName:方法,有就直接调用赋值 假如没有找到setName:方法,就会继续查找有没有_name属性,有就_name = value赋值 假如没有找到_name,还会继续查找模型中有没有name属性 最终没有找 ...
分类:
其他好文 时间:
2016-05-24 18:39:41
阅读次数:
214
1. KVC的实现原理 遍历字典里面所有的key,以name为例 去模型中查找有没有setName:方法,有就直接调用赋值 假如没有找到setName:方法,就会继续查找有没有_name属性,有就_name = value赋值 假如没有找到_name,还会继续查找模型中有没有name属性 最终没有找 ...
分类:
移动开发 时间:
2016-05-24 15:17:37
阅读次数:
145
1. KVC的实现原理 遍历字典里面所有的key,以name为例 去模型中查找有没有setName:方法,有就直接调用赋值 假如没有找到setName:方法,就会继续查找有没有_name属性,有就_name = value赋值 假如没有找到_name,还会继续查找模型中有没有name属性 最终没有找 ...
分类:
移动开发 时间:
2016-05-23 00:50:00
阅读次数:
213
说明:转自文顶顶 一、使用 for 循环 要遍历字典、数组或者是集合,for 循环是最简单也用的比较多的方法 优点:简单 缺点:由于字典和集合内部是无序的,导致我们在遍历字典和集合的时候需要借助一个新的【数组】作为中介来处理,多出一部分开支 二、使用 for...in遍历 在Objective-C ...
分类:
移动开发 时间:
2016-04-12 23:59:51
阅读次数:
530
本文转自文顶顶,稍加修改 1.for循环 要遍历字典、数组或者是集合,for循环是最简单也用的比较多的方法 优点:简单 缺点:由于字典和集合内部是无序的,导致我们在遍历字典和集合的时候需要借助一个新的『数组』作为中介来处理,多出了一部分开销。 2.for....in....遍历 在Objective ...
分类:
移动开发 时间:
2016-04-08 20:05:48
阅读次数:
219
1.dict,字典,键值对person={"name":"alex","age":19,"gender":"man"}person[‘name‘]通过key值来获取2.遍历字典键值,字典无序。foreleK,eleVinperson.items(): printeleK printeleVperson.keys()所有keyperson.values()所有value3.文件操作file(文件路劲,模式)模式:r,w,a,r+..
分类:
编程语言 时间:
2016-04-05 20:09:46
阅读次数:
204
iOS开发实用技巧—Objective-C中的各种遍历(迭代)方式 说明: 1)该文简短介绍在iOS开发中遍历字典、数组和集合的几种常见方式。 2)该文对应的代码可以在下面的地址获得:https://github.com/HanGangAndHanMeimei/Code 一、使用for循环 要遍历字
分类:
移动开发 时间:
2016-03-07 22:34:36
阅读次数:
307
解决数据请求json解析字典后,由于java某些类库转换json字符串后出现键值为<null>无法保存在userDefault。 打印下得到的字典数据: “username”=<null> 此时如果将字典保存到userDefault中会报错 所以需要遍历字典将其替换 for (NSString*s
分类:
移动开发 时间:
2016-03-01 12:55:24
阅读次数:
229
1 NSArray *cityArray = [NSArray arrayWithObjects:@"中国北京",@"中国郑州",@"中国洛阳",@"中国杭州",@"中国香港",@"中国台湾", nil]; 2 NSDictionary *personInforDic = [N...
分类:
编程语言 时间:
2016-01-18 10:24:22
阅读次数:
248
// Playground - noun: a place where people can playimport UIKit//------------------------------------------------------------------------------// 1. f...
分类:
编程语言 时间:
2015-12-18 10:36:40
阅读次数:
171